lets talk v amp 2 patches
well i just love my v amp 2 from behringer,, ever snce a friend of mine from guitarbattle hooked me on it, and i been using it ever since.. my seting lately is this....
british hi gain for amp
no mid
treble at 4
gain is at 5 to 10.. depends on heaviness of the tune im doing...
bass is at 4
volume half way up
master all way up
flanger effect with effects knob set to 6
reverb is at 4
and my fender american standard strat i been using lately...
thats it...thats tone im using lately till I mess around for more lol

Attention all Vamp users:
While the POD can plug into a PC directly with a USB cable the Vamp2/Pro needs a MIDI control cable. I have one that goes from MIDI IN/OUT to USB I got at GC for $30.
Here is one at MF for $15 that uses the joystick port of your sound card. MIDI CABLE
After you get this, simply go Behringer web site
and download Vamp Editor Software.
Then you go Vamp.com and upload/download tons of custom patches.
You be able to store and recall lots of settings by song title and never actually touch the V-amp unit again...and have easy access to all the settings that are hard to get to with the front panel control menus.

you v-amp2 owners should try using the custom hi-gain amp, with about 3 mid, 7-8 treble, 7 bass, and 6-7 gain. cabinet 15, noise gate about 7, and little bit of delay to get that eddie tone (FUCK era, and 5150 and Van Halen3)
